Video: Jeezy feat. Janelle Monáe - 'Sweet Life'

In honor of Martin Luther King, Jr. Day, Pastor Young preaches to the people in the powerful video for “Sweet Life” featuring Janelle Monáe. The black-and-white clip shines a spotlight on criminal justice reform and opens with Jeezy reading a newspaper article about youth imprisonment. Throughout the clip, there are scenes of police officers arresting a young black man, prisons, and gun violence.

“Ever since I came into this music game, I’ve tried to make motivational music, whether you’re on the corner hustling or in the corner office making power moves,” Jeezy told CNN. “‘Sweet Life’ is no different, but it’s a bit more of a personal track because I rap about my own trials and tribulations. I wanted this video, with Janelle Monáe, to show what could have happened to me and does happen to African Americans every day.”

The song comes off his latest album Church in These Streets, which debuted at No. 4 (107,000) in November.
